This is the relationship between Jia Haixa and his friend Jia Wenqi.
Haixa is completely blind in both eyes and Wenqi is a double amputee. The pair work together to plant trees in Yeli village, just outside of Shijiazhuang city in northern China.

IMAGE: IMAGINECHINA/CORBIS
They hope to transform the area by planting 1,000 trees every year.

IMAGE: IMAGINECHINA/CORBIS
So far they've planted 10,000 trees.
